cnc有什么编程软件

worktile 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    CNC(Computer Numerical Control)是数控机床的简称,它通过计算机控制来实现工件的加工。而编程软件则是用来编写CNC程序的工具。下面我将介绍几种常见的CNC编程软件。

    1. G代码编程软件:
      G代码是一种常用的数控机床编程语言,用来描述机床的运动轨迹和加工指令。常见的G代码编程软件有Mastercam、PowerMill、FeatureCAM等。这些软件提供了丰富的功能,可以创建复杂的加工路径,同时也具备仿真功能,可以模拟出加工过程。

    2. CAD/CAM集成软件:
      CAD(Computer-Aided Design)和CAM(Computer-Aided Manufacturing)软件可以实现产品的设计和加工过程的无缝集成。常见的CAD/CAM软件有CAMWorks、SolidCAM等。这些软件可以直接读取3D设计模型,并根据加工要求自动生成CNC程序,极大地提高了编程效率。

    3. 编程编辑软件:
      适用于编写简单程序的编程编辑软件有Notepad++、EditCNC等。它们提供了简洁的界面和常用的编程功能,如语法高亮、代码折叠、自动补全等,方便程序员进行编写和调试。

    4. 模拟仿真软件:
      为了验证编写的CNC程序是否正确,可以使用模拟仿真软件进行虚拟加工。常见的模拟仿真软件有Vericut、NCSimul等。这些软件可以将CNC程序加载到虚拟机床上进行模拟,检查加工路径、刀具运动等,避免在实际加工中出现错误。

    总结起来,CNC编程软件的选择应根据具体应用需求和个人编程经验来决定。对于初学者来说,建议先选择一款易于上手的软件进行学习,熟悉基本的编程语言和功能,逐步提高编程水平。随着经验的积累,可以尝试更高级的软件,提升编程效率和加工质量。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    CNC(数控机床)是一种通过计算机程序控制的机械加工设备。CNC编程软件用于创建和编辑CNC机床的加工程序。这些软件允许用户以图形界面或文本格式输入各种指令和参数,以便机床能够按照预定的路径和方式进行加工。

    以下是一些常用的CNC编程软件:

    1. Mastercam:Mastercam是一款功能强大的CNC编程软件,广泛应用于铣削、车削、线切割等多种加工工艺。它提供丰富的工具和功能,使操作者能够创建高质量的加工程序。

    2. Siemens NX:Siemens NX是一款综合型的CAD/CAM/CAE软件,其中包括用于CNC编程的模块。它支持多种机床类型和加工工艺,具有先进的功能和用户友好的界面。

    3. Autodesk Fusion 360:Autodesk Fusion 360是一款云端CAD/CAM软件,提供强大的CNC编程和仿真功能。它具有直观的界面和易于使用的工具,适用于初学者和专业人士。

    4. PowerMill:PowerMill是由Autodesk开发的专业级CNC编程软件,主要用于高精度雕刻、模具制造等应用。它具有高效的路径优化和仿真功能,能够生成高质量的加工程序。

    5. Edgecam:Edgecam是一款专注于车削和铣削的CNC编程软件。它支持多轴机床和复杂的加工工艺,具有直观的界面和强大的编辑功能。

    这些软件在市场上享有很高的声誉,并且被广泛用于各种行业,如汽车、航空航天、模具制造等。不同的软件适用于不同的应用场景和技术要求,用户可以根据自己的需求选择适合的软件来进行CNC编程。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    CNC机床编程软件是用来生成和编辑数控机床程序的工具。它通过将工件的几何形状和加工要求翻译成机床能够理解的指令,实现对工件的自动化加工。以下是几种常用的CNC机床编程软件。

    1. Mastercam:Mastercam是一款功能强大的CNC编程软件,广泛应用于各种类型的机床。它具有直观的用户界面和丰富的功能,支持多种编程方式,包括2D和3D建模、形态刀路生成、后处理等。

    2. GibbsCAM:GibbsCAM是一款全面的CNC编程软件,适用于多种机床和加工技术。它提供了灵活的工具路径生成功能,支持直接导入CAD文件、智能特征识别和自动化编程等功能。

    3. PowerMill:PowerMill是由Autodesk开发的一款专业的CNC编程软件,主要用于5轴加工。它提供了高级的加工策略和刀具路径生成功能,能够优化切削时间和加工质量。

    4. CATIA:CATIA是一款综合性的CAD/CAM软件,广泛应用于航空、汽车和工业设计等领域。它具有强大的3D建模和工具路径生成功能,支持多种机床编程。

    5. Siemens NX:Siemens NX是一款功能强大的CNC编程软件,适用于多种机床和加工策略。它提供了全面的刀具路径生成和后处理功能,能够实现高效的加工过程。

    除了以上的软件,还有许多其他的CNC机床编程软件,如AlphaCAM、EdgeCAM、ProCAM等。选择合适的软件取决于用户的具体需求和预算。在选择软件时,还需要考虑软件的易用性、技术支持和培训等方面。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部